AUCTION DATE - WEDNESDAY, AUGUST 27, AT 4 PM. LISTED PRICE IS AN OPENING BID ONLY AND IS NOT INDICATIVE OF THE FINAL SALE PRICE. REAL ESTATE: 1 sty. Holland stone one owner ranch style dwl. w/ 2012 SF finished area, eat-in kitchen w/ raised panel cabinets, pantry & appliances, dining, living & family rms. , 3 bdrms. (primary bdrm. w/ primary bath), 3 full baths, 1st floor laundry/mudroom, attic, daylight bsmt. w/ partially finished rec. rm. & utility rm. , oil HW heat, central AC, insulated windows, built-in 2 car garage all on 1.8 ACRE partially wooded lot w/ country setting, on-site well & septic. NOTE: Spacious one-owner house in need of TLC & your choice of upgrades. Convenient location, minutes to Plowville & Morgantown w/ easy access to Rts. 10, 568 & Turnpike. Terms 10% down, balance 60 days or before. Personal Inspection by appointment or open house Sat. , August 16 & 23 from 1 to 4 PM.

RR
Rural Residential District
The purpose of this district to foster the continued existence of watersheds, woodlands, and agriculture and to protect critical natural areas such as steep slopes, watercourses, water supplies, and ecosystems. Low-density single- family development is permitted, though conservation by design will allow concentrations of development when significant portions of the tract are permanently reserved for open space. The following are specific purposes for this district: To conserve open land, including those areas containing unique and sensitive natural features such as woodlands, steep slopes, streams, floodplains and wetlands, by setting them aside from development.; To provide greater design flexibility and efficiency in the siting of services and infrastructure, including the opportunity to reduce length of roads, utility runs, and the amount of paving required for residential development.; To reduce erosion and sedimentation by the retention of existing vegetation and the minimization of development on steep slopes.; To provide for a variety of lotting opportunities.; To implement adopted Township policies to conserve a variety of irreplaceable and environmentally sensitive resource lands as set forth in the Comprehensive Plan.; To protect areas of the Township with productive agricultural soils for continued or future agricultural use by conserving blocks of land large enough to allow for efficient farm operations.; To create neighborhoods with direct visual access to open land, with amenities in the form of neighborhood open space.; To provide for the conservation and maintenance of open land within the Township to achieve the above-mentioned goals and for active or passive recreational use by residents.
